Is the AA schedule change significant enough that you'd qualify for a refund or reissuing of the ticket to a later flight? I would never trust this connection given that:
1) CUN can be a zoo that time of day;
2) Cubana's punctuality leaves much to be desired;
3) this is obviously on two separate tickets;
4) these two airlines have no way to communicate with each other;
5) you'll have no way to communicate with AA in the event of a delay.